The Next Phase was established in 1995 as a medical industry market research and market development consulting firm. The company's President & CEO, Victoria Hunsicker Sanko, is a chemical engineer, biochemist with an MBA in marketing and finance.

The Next Phase is a Registered Establishment with the U.S. FDA, registration #3006-32-6675.

Mor-Gal Plastic Ltd. was established in 1990 as a plastic products manufacturer. The company's CEO & General Manager, Tamir Francois-Berman, is an electronic engineer, Tel-Aviv University, with advanced courses in business.

Mor-Gal’s facility includes plastic injection machines and assembly lines. The company is an approved supplier for leading companies in Israel, Western Europe and North America.

SidePinch Clamps are in demand by leading Medical Device Manufacturers, on an OEM basis, to replace conventional pinch clamps, and one-way stopcocks and valves at highly competitive pricing.

SidePinch Clamps are also in demand by chief nurses and doctors in a variety of hospitals and by multi-national device, research and medical laboratory products companies as stand-alone devices. In all cases the response is clear:

"Doctors and nurses require smarter closing, clamping, and contamination prevention devices which are low cost and easy to use."

The SidePinch Clamp (SPC) meets their needs. This highly innovative SidePinch Clamp enables the medical staff to make adjustments to any tube, catheter, cannula or tubing set on site by removing or adding the clamp anywhere at any time during the procedure without breaking existing tubing connections. SPCs also reduce the use of expensive one-way stopcocks and valves.

US Patent No. 6,234,448 protects the SidePinch Clamp; in other countries patents are pending.
